How long will the top last???
Seller claims the top is original and in perfect shape. Car has 90,000 miles on it, said it was always garaged. I really like it because you hardly ever see the verts with a six speed.How durable are the tops on these things? Where do they tend to leak? What should I look for that typically breaks? Car looks like it was taken care of, hardly any wear on the driver's seat.
Only common problem is the rear window eventually becomes detached from the cloth since the glue deteriorates. Good news is that you can replace that portion only for a few hundred bucks.

So that top went nine years with harsh treatment down in LA. My olds which isn't as nice a top, I have had for 6 years and I would guess that top was at least 8 or more year old when I bought it, is shot and falling apart... so if you replace it with a cheap top... I would say, 5 years of life.
As for leaks I have never seen a leak.
As for leaks, this is my second convertible and never had a leak. I did once feel a squirt of water when I hit a bump. It came through the place where the weatherstripping of the top meets the windshield.
